Output 68ba2d71ca9170796088ca4cd38bdd003626ddfc2c15ec837ab2baba280df82f:2

value
2829118324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7814f75a4f0b47b92853f9fa9228b368a3ed38fa OP_EQUAL
address
3Cdx8KdZcm2ChjQ2z8V1JmjzfYBaWLYnqj
transaction
68ba2d71ca9170796088ca4cd38bdd003626ddfc2c15ec837ab2baba280df82f
confirmations
147931
spent
true